What Causes Itching Across Body Along With Swelling And Redness?

default
Posted on Mon, 7 Sep 2015
Question: Random areas on my body itches and itchy areas are swelled up and red.
Mostly on hands and legs.
The Palm and Feet itchiness is accompanied by mild pain.
Increases at nights mostly.

It started all with a blood test done as part of my medical examination.
Around the area the syringe was inserted was red.
Also i was diagnosed with deficiency of Vitamin D(6.4) and B12(on borderline).
Since then the itching is happening.

It almost a month now the symptom has been occurring.
The area i live in has avg temperature of 26 degree C through out the day. Nights are around 19 degree C.

If i take Vitamin Supplements i feel the itching increases.

The condition which you have is known as Urticaria Or Hives.
Urticaria/ Hives usually presents as skin welts/swellings, which can be distributed all over the body. Itching is commonly associated and varies from mild to extreme.

Urticaria OR hives can happen due to various causes which may be discovered on carefully questioning the patient:

--Infections (e.g common cold, flu, gastointestinal infection etc)
--Drugs (Pain killers, antibiotics, multivitamins etc)
--Certain foods and food additives/preservatives
--Physical Urticaria: Cold temperature, Heat, Pressure(Prolonged Standing, Sitting), Dermographism etc.
--Cholinergic Urticaria: in response to strong emotions, exercise, spicy food etc
--Autoimmune disorders like lupus (SLE), rheumatoid arthritis (RA) etc.

However, 50% of cases have no underlying discoverable cause for their urticaria and are known as idiopathic urticaria.

In your case it could very well be drug induced Or drug aggravated i.e Vitamin supplements, as you have also noticed that the itch severity is related to vitamin intake. Therefore I suggest you to discontinue multivitamins.

Instead of taking vitamin supplement you may add dietary sources rich in these vitamins like milk and other dairy products, fish etc which are good sources of vitamin D as well as Vitamin B 12.

For urticaria you may take symptomatic treatment for a few more days i.e tablet cetrizine and tablet allegra for another 2 weeks.
Topically you may use a soothing lotion e.g calamine/ calasoft lotion.

Other drugs like pain killers and antibiotics too can also cause this type of reaction.
